KPMG in Canada has announced the appointment of Benjie Thomas as its next Chief Executive Officer, effective October 1, 2024. Thomas will succeed Elio Luongo, who is concluding two consecutive terms on September 30, 2024. Christopher Morales Williams, who hails from Vaughan, Ontario, continues to make waves in the athletics world with his remarkable performances this season. The 19-year-old athlete delivered an outstanding performance at the Southeastern Conference (SEC) outdoor championships on last Saturday, clinching victory in the men’s 400-meter event with a world-leading time of 44.05 seconds. In an impressive feat, Belize, Jamaica, and St. Vincent and the Grenadines have received prestigious certification from the World Health Organization (WHO) for their successful elimination of HIV and syphilis transmission from mother to child.
